Abstract:
A friction inhibiting compound of the present invention is a friction inhibiting compound including a copolymer (A) that includes a polymerizable monomer (a) and a polymerizable monomer (b) as constituent monomers, wherein the polymerizable monomer (a) includes a specific alkyl acrylate or alkyl methacrylate, the polymerizable monomer (b) is at least one selected from the group consisting of specific hydroxyalkyl acrylates and hydroxyalkyl methacrylates; specific alkyl acrylates and alkyl methacrylates; and aromatic vinyl monomers having 8 to 14 carbon atoms, and a composition ratio of the polymerizable monomer (a) and polymerizable monomer (b) in the copolymer (A), represented by (a):(b), is (10 to 45):(55 to 90) in a molar ratio (provided that a total molar ratio of (a) and (b) is 100), and the weight average molecular weight of the copolymer (A) is 1,000 to 500,000.

Abstract:
The present invention provides an acrylate-based copolymer obtained by polymerizing constituent monomers including a polymerizable monomer (a) consisting of an alkyl acrylate-based monomer represented by the following general formula (1) in an amount of from 10 mol % to 95 mol % with respect to a total number of moles of the constituent monomers, a polymerizable monomer (b) consisting of an alkylene glycol acrylate-based monomer represented by the following general formula (2) in an amount of from 5 mol % to 50 mol % with respect to the total number of moles of the constituent monomers, and at least one kind of polymerizable monomer (c) selected from the group consisting of an aromatic vinyl-based monomer (c-1) and a short-chain alkyl acrylate-based monomer (c-2) represented by the following general formula (3) in an amount of from 0 mol % to 60 mol % with respect to the total number of moles of the constituent monomers. In the formula (1), R1 represents an alkyl group having 4 to 18 carbon atoms, and Al represents a hydrogen atom. In the formula (2), R2 represents an alkylene group having 2 to 4 carbon atoms, R3 represents a hydrogen atom or an alkyl group having 1 to 30 carbon atoms, A2 represents a hydrogen atom, and “n” represents a number from 2 to 20. In the formula (3), R4 represents an alkyl group having 1 to 3 carbon atoms, and A3 represents a hydrogen atom.
Abstract:
A lubricant composition containing a base oil and organic fine particles substantially consisting of the three elements of carbon, hydrogen and oxygen and having a proportion of particles having a particle diameter of 10 nm to 10 μm of 90% or greater, wherein the content of the organic fine particles is 0.01 to 50 parts by mass relative to 100 parts by mass of the base oil.

Abstract:
The purpose of the present invention is to provide an additive for lubricating oil, which does not substantially contain metal elements or the like and is safe but which demonstrates extreme pressure performance equivalent to conventional extreme pressure agents each containing a metal element when used in lubricating applications.In order to ach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the present invention provides a friction and wear reducing agent for lubricating oil consisting of a copolymer (A) comprising an alkyl acrylate (a) represented by the following general formula (1) and a hydroxyalkyl acrylate (b) represented by the following general formula (2) as essential constituent monomers, wherein the constitutive ratio of (a) to (b) is 50/50 to 90/10 (molar ratio) and the weight average molecular weight thereof is 2,000 to less than 40,000. (in the above formula, R′ represents an alkyl group having 10 to 18 carbon atoms) (in the above formula, R2 represents an alkylene group having 2 to 4 carbon atoms)
